Streamlining Data Pipelines: The Synergies of Airflow and Claude

In today's data-driven world, optimized data pipelines are paramount for businesses to glean actionable insights and make informed decisions. Airflow, an open-source workflow management platform, has emerged as a popular choice for orchestrating complex data processing tasks. However, when it comes to handling unstructured data or requiring sophisticated language understanding capabilities, Airflow typically falls short. This is where Claude, a powerful AI assistant developed by Anthropic, steps in. By integrating Claude into Airflow pipelines, organizations can unlock a new level of automation and intelligence.

Claude's extensive language processing abilities empower Airflow to tackle tasks such as text extraction, sentiment analysis, and natural language generation. For instance, Claude can be used to automatically process incoming emails, extract key information, and trigger specific actions within the pipeline. This partnership between Airflow and Claude not only accelerates data processing workflows but also unlocks innovative use cases that were previously challenging.

  • Additionally, integrating Claude into Airflow pipelines allows for dynamic workflows. Claude can analyze incoming data and make instantaneous decisions about the best course of action, dynamically adjusting the pipeline's execution path as needed.
